C# UserControl 可见属性

Posted

技术标签:

【中文标题】C# UserControl 可见属性【英文标题】:C# UserControl Visible Property 【发布时间】:2011-01-18 16:22:20 【问题描述】:

如何覆盖 UserControl Visible 属性?或者当控件更改其Visible 状态时,我如何确定它?

稍后编辑:我需要它在 .NET CF 3.5 中工作。

谢谢。

【问题讨论】:

【参考方案1】:

我终于通过添加 new Visible 属性解决了这个问题,该属性正在设置 base.Visible 属性并执行我的自定义工作。

【讨论】:

就是这样。接受你的回答:-)【参考方案2】:

尝试订阅IsVisibleChanged事件

【讨论】:

在我看来这在 CF 版本中不受支持。

以上是关于C# UserControl 可见属性的主要内容,如果未能解决你的问题,请参考以下文章

如何处理 UserControl 中属性的可见性?

WPF - 将 UserControl 可见性绑定到属性

如何将 WPF DataGrid DataColumns 可见性绑定到 UserControl 的 ViewModel 上的属性?

如何处理用户控件中属性的可见性?

使用C#开发ActiveX控件

当焦点可见时,将焦点设置为usercontrol